PARIS (Reuters) - Sanofi's head of vaccines David Loew will quit to become chief executive of Ipsen from July 1, the two French drugmakers said on Friday.The announcement comes at a critical time as Sanofi is working on two vaccine projects to protect against COVID-19, the illness caused by the new coronavirus.Loew, who has been with Sanofi for almost seven years and in charge of the vaccines unit since 2016, will fill a management vacuum at Ipsen, which has been struggling to find a new CEO..
